3 Usual Root Causes Of Water Spots on Walls


Contrary to popular belief, water discolorations on walls do not constantly originate from poor building materials. There are numerous reasons for water discolorations on walls. These include:

Poor Drain


When making a structure plan, it is vital to make certain adequate drain. This will stop water from leaking right into the wall surfaces. Where the drain system is blocked or missing, below ground wetness accumulates. This links to too much wetness that you see on the walls of your building.
So, the leading source of wet wall surfaces, in this situation, can be an inadequate water drainage system. It can likewise be because of bad monitoring of sewer pipes that go through the building.

Damp


When warm moist air consults with dry cool air, it creates water beads to base on the wall surfaces of buildings. When there is steam from food preparation or showers, this happens in shower rooms and also kitchens. The water droplets can discolor the surrounding walls in these parts of your home as well as infect various other locations.
Damp or condensation affects the roofing as well as wall surfaces of buildings. This triggers them to show up darker than other areas of the house. When the wall surface is wet, it develops a suitable setting for the growth of microorganisms and also fungis. These might have damaging effects on health and wellness, such as allergies as well as respiratory conditions.

Pipe Leaks


A lot of residences have a network of water pipes within the wall surfaces. It always enhances the stability of such pipes, as there is little oxygen within the wall surfaces.
Yet, a drawback to this is that water leak impacts the walls of the structure and causes prevalent damage. An indicator of faulty pipes is the look of a water stain on the wall.

    How to Remove Water Stains From Your Walls Without Repainting


    The easy way to get water stains off walls


    Water stains aren’t going to appear on tile; they need a more absorbent surface, which is why they show up on bare walls. Since your walls are probably painted, this presents a problem: How can you wash a wall without damaging it and risk needing to repait the entire room?


    According to Igloo Surfaces, you should start gently and only increase the intensity of your cleaning methods if basic remedies don’t get the job done. Start with a simple solution of dish soap and warm water, at a ratio of about one to two. Use a cloth dipped in the mixture to apply the soapy water to your stain. Gently rub it in from the top down, then rinse with plain water and dry thoroughly with a hair dryer on a cool setting.



    If that doesn’t work, fill a spray bottle with a mixture of vinegar, lemon juice, and baking soda. Shake it up and spray it on the stain. Leave it for about an hour, then use a damp cloth to rub it away. You may have to repeat this process a few times to get the stain all the way out, so do this when you have time for multiple hour-long soaking intervals.


    How to get water stains out of wood


    Maybe you have wood paneling or cabinets that are looking grody from water stains too, whether in your kitchen or bathroom. Per Better Homes and Gardens, you have a few options for removing water marks on your wooden surfaces.


  • You can let mayonnaise sit on your stain overnight, then wipe it away in the morning and polish your wood afterward.


  • You can also mix equal parts vinegar and olive oil and apply to the stain with a cloth, wiping in the direction of the grain until the stain disappears. Afterward, wipe the surface down with a clean, dry cloth.


  • Try placing an iron on a low heat setting over a cloth on top of the stain. Press it down for a few seconds and remove it to see if the stain is letting up, then try again until you’re satisfied. (Be advised that this works best for still-damp stains.)
